奇瑞公司人事档案管理系统需求规格说明书

需积分: 0 0 下载量 20 浏览量 更新于2024-09-19 收藏 207KB DOC 举报
"人事档案说明书" 该文档是一份关于人事档案管理系统的详细说明书,涵盖了系统的需求分析、项目概述、运行环境、条件与限制、数据描述、需求规定等多个方面。以下是相关知识点的详细介绍: 1. **需求分析**:需求分析是软件开发过程中的关键步骤,它确保了开发团队对用户需求的清晰理解,为软件开发提供指南,并形成软件需求规格说明书。这个阶段定义了软件的功能性和非功能性需求,为后续设计和实现奠定了基础。 2. **数据字典**:数据字典是关于数据的信息集合,包含了数据流图中各个元素的定义,如数据项、数据流、数据存储等,是理解和解析数据流图的重要工具。 3. **VB(Visual Basic)**:VB是一种可视化的编程语言,用于开发Windows应用程序,适用于快速开发简单易用的用户界面。 4. **项目概述**:项目目标明确了人事档案管理系统旨在提升企业人力资源管理效率,通过信息化手段简化人事档案管理工作。系统需能在企业内部网络的任意计算机上运行。 5. **运行环境**:系统运行在企业内部网络环境中,用户需有权限登录系统。 6. **条件与限制**:考虑到经费和时间限制,开发选择了VB作为编程语言。 7. **数据流图**:数据流图描述了系统中数据的流动和处理过程,包括系统账户管理、人事档案管理和系统数据管理的数据流图,这些图形化表示有助于理解系统的工作流程。 8. **E-R图(实体-关系图)**:E-R图用于表示数据库中实体间的关系,是数据库设计的关键部分,此系统中可能涉及员工、部门、职务等实体及其关系。 9. **状态图**:状态图展示了用户从登录系统到导出报表的各个状态变化,反映了用户交互的流程。 10. **需求规定**: - 功能需求包括系统账户管理(如登录、退出、操作记录)、人事档案管理(如个人信息录入、查询、浏览、打印)以及数据管理(如备份恢复、部门数据管理)。 - 性能规定涉及到数据的精度(如日期、年月、工龄要求为整数)和时间特性(系统处理、查询和统计速度需满足用户需求)。 这份说明书为人事档案管理系统的开发提供了全面的指导,包括系统的功能规划、性能标准和操作流程,是软件开发团队进行设计和实现的重要依据。